Troubleshooting Common Issues

Appliance Not Working

Check power connection and voltage correspondence.

Water Leaks

Ensure water tank is not overfilled beyond MAX level.

Slow Brewing

Descale the appliance to remove scale blockage.

Noise and Steam During Brewing

Ensure appliance is not blocked by scale; descale if necessary.

Coffee Grounds in Jug

Use correct filter size, ensure paper filter is intact, and jug is positioned correctly.

Weak Coffee

Use right filter size, correct coffee-to-water ratio, and ensure filter doesn't collapse.

Coffee Not Hot Enough

Ensure jug is properly on hotplate; brew more than 3 cups for better temp.

Low Coffee Volume in Jug

Ensure jug is properly placed on hotplate for drip stop to function.

Stubborn Jug Deposits

Clean metal jug with hot water and sodium carbonate solution.

Filter Overflow During Brewing

Check filter holder position and avoid removing jug for over 20 seconds.

Descaling the Coffee Maker

Descale every two months using white vinegar for excessive steaming or slow brewing.

Auto Shut-off Function

Appliance switches off automatically after 30 minutes for energy saving.
